  16. Just a quick shout out to those who want to try a 90 degree mount on their revolver and currently have the Allchin mount. John has come up with a retro-fit 90 degree mount that will work with your current mount. It will lower your C-More .155 lower than the BMT and weighs .4oz lighter. With the aluminum body C-More you will have to trim one of the battery cover screws or the mount itself, either one would be minor fitting. With the plastic body C-More no fitting would be necessary. The original mount would also serve as a blast shield for the lens. I have added some pictures to show the difference. Either mount is an excellent mount this just gives you a different route if you already own a Allchin mount and would like to go to a 90 degree mount..
